JOB SUMMARY/PURPOSE:

The Maintenance Team Leader reports directly to the Plant Manager.  They direct, lead, and supervise a team of maintenance personnel in a plant environment at a Natural Gas power plant while sharing responsibility for its safe, efficient, and reliable operation.  This position’s primary responsibility is to oversee the maintenance program of the plant including both routine and outage work. This position oversees, manages, optimizes and fully implements the Conditioned Based Outage/Integrated Planning Process (aka Stage Gate Process).  Outage oversight responsibilities include both planning and execution phases of outages.  This position participates in development of the multi-year tactical and strategic project identification and budgeting processes.  This position effectively manages maintenance issues to support system needs, evaluates performance of and develops direct reports, maintains high standards of diversity and inclusion, ethics and integrity, and drives continuous improvement by serving as a champion of change.
